WesternCoin provide no information on their website about who owns or runs the business.
The WesternCoin website domain (“westerncoin.co”) was privately registered on September 14th, 2017.
As always, if an MLM company is not openly upfront about who is running or owns it, think long and hard about joining and/or handing over any money.
WesternCoin Products
WesternCoin has no retailable products or services, with affiliates only able to market WesternCoin affiliate membership itself.
The WesternCoin Compensation Plan
WesternCoin affiliates invest in the WNC crypocurrency on the promise of monthly ROIs of up to 45%.
invest $100 to $499 and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 240 days
invest $500 to $999 and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 210 days plus 0.05% bonus
invest $1000 to $4999 and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 180 days plus 0.10% bonus
invest $5000 to $9999 and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 150 days plus 0.2% bonus
invest $10,000 to $49,999 and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 120 days plus 0.25% bonus
invest $50,000 to $99,999 and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 90 days plus 0.3% bonus
invest $100,000 or more and receive a monthly ROI of up to 45% for 60 days plus 0.35% bonus
At the end of the maturity period WesternCoin also pay out the initially invested amount.
Referral commissions are paid on invested funds and ROI payments via a unilevel compensation structure.
A unilevel compensation structure places an affiliate at the top of a unilevel team, with every personally recruited affiliate placed directly under them (level 1):
If any level 1 affiliates recruit new affiliates, they are placed on level 2 of the original affiliate’s unilevel team.
If any level 2 affiliates recruit new affiliates, they are placed on level 3 and so on and so forth down a theoretical infinite number of levels.
WesternCoin cap payable unilevel levels at ten, with commissions paid out as follows:
level 1 (personally recruited affiliates) – 8% referral commission and 5% ROI commission
level 2 – 3% referral commission and 1% ROI commission
level 3 – 2% referral commission and 1% ROI commission
level 4 – 1% referral commission and 1% ROI commission
levels 5 and 6 – 1% referral commission and 0.5% ROI commission
level 7 – 1% referral commission and 0.3% ROI commission
level 8 – 0.5% referral commission and 0.3% ROI commission
level 9 – 0.3% referral commission and 0.2% ROI commission
level 10 – 0.2% referral commission and 0.2 % ROI commission
Joining WesternCoin
WesternCoin affiliate membership is free, however affiliates must invest in at least $100 worth of WNC to participate in the attached income opportunity.
Conclusion
WesternCoin is yet another altcoin propped up by Ponzi fraud.
The ruse sees affiliates initially invest with in premined WNC, which are owned by the WesternCoin admin(s).
